### v2.8.0 — Changed defaults

Cold starts on Ferngate handlers were averaging 4s due to eager dependency loading. Default init mode is now lazy; provisioned warm pool size raised from 0 to 2. Support impact: fewer timeout complaints, but first-invocation latency tickets may mention slower library calls. Affected handlers redeploy automatically. The new default configuration values are below.

service settings:
PRAIX_LOG_LEVEL=error
PRAIX_METRICS_HOST=metrics.praix.qorvelcorp.corp
PRAIX_POOL_SIZE=16

// REINDEX_BATCH_CAP limits docs per shard pass in the Tallowfield
// nightly search reindex. Raising it starves the ingest queue;
// lowering it overruns the maintenance window. 5000 is the tested
// sweet spot. Change only with a soak run. Verified against the
// build noted below.

session token of bawif-hahog = htk6_ac5981

# Service Accounts — Templater Perf Work

The svc-templater-bench account exists solely to drive load tests against the Quillforge rendering tier. Scope: read-only on template store, write to the perf-metrics bucket. No production render permissions. Created for the Q3 latency investigation; flagged for review at quarter end. Rotation cadence is 30 days, enforced by the Keywheel job. Access is logged to the audit stream with full request bodies redacted. For review purposes, the currently active key for this account is recorded below.

gateway credential: kto23_LX9A4ys6i4nzHtpOLNLodKK

## Changelog — Font vendoring defaults changed

As of this release, the Bracken UI build no longer fetches third-party fonts at build time. All typefaces used by the Lanternwell suite are now vendored into the repo under a dedicated assets directory, and the fetch step is skipped by default. If you're onboarding, nothing to install — the fonts travel with the checkout. The build flags controlling this behavior are listed below.

settings of hadup-yafog:
LAMAEL_PIN=3761
LAMAEL_TENANT=istmir
LAMAEL_METRICS_HOST=metrics.lamael.plorvasys.test
LAMAEL_SEAL=seal_8ea68500
LAMAEL_STANDBY_TEAM=fraok